Carsome reports first quarterly profit, “on track” to achieve first full-year profitability this year

Carsome has also marked another achievement in its growth trajectory, surpassing the sale of 500,000 cars since its inception in 2015. This milestone was achieved in just two years after crossing 100,000 cars in 2021. Last year, the group sold over 150,000 cars.

Princeton Digital Group secures $280M green loan for AI-ready data center campus in Malaysia

Princeton Digital Group (PDG), Asia’s leading data center provider, has secured its first MYR 1.27 billion ($280 million) green loan for its 150MW artificial intelligence (AI)-ready JH1 campus in Sedenak Tech Park (STeP) in Johor, Malaysia.

Microsoft to invest $2.2B in cloud and AI in Malaysia

American technology firm Microsoft has on Thursday announced that it will invest $2.2 billion over the next four years to support Malaysia’s digital transformation – the single largest investment in its 32-year history in the country.
